Whos A Good Candidate For Hip Implants

Most healthy adults can undergo hip augmentation safely. During your initial consultation, your surgeon will ask you about your medical history and lifestyle. To ensure surgery is safe for you, youll have to undergo a basic physical exam and do routine blood work.

People of all genders seek out hip dip surgery via implants, but its particularly popular for transgender women and some cisgender women with narrower hips who want to create a more traditionally feminine figure.

The quality of skin in the hip area plays a significant role in whether youre a good candidate. Younger patients usually have thicker skin and more dense tissue, which produces a more seamless outcome, says Dr. Stanton.

The density and quality of tissue coverageskin, fat, and underlying fasciais often more important than how much fat the patient has in the hip area, he explains.

Some patientsfor instance, those whove had prior liposuction of the hips, or substances such as liquid silicone injectedhave to be evaluated very carefully and the implants made of a conservative thickness.

Another common scenario is patients whove had a BBL where much of the fat didnt survive. These patients are evaluated by physical exam on a case-by-case basis to make sure their tissue is still of good enough quality to undergo cosmetic hip implant surgery, says Dr. Stanton.

What Happens During A Hip Dip Fat Transfer Procedure

The fat transfer procedure is typically performed with local anesthesia and will take between three to four hours.

The first part of the process is liposuction. Very small incisions are made near the area where fat will be removed. A long, thin tube called a cannula is used to break up and gently suction out the unwanted fat. Once the fat is removed, it is purified in a centrifuge. The centrifuge spins the fat to remove fluids and blood without damaging the fat cells. The fat cells are then placed into a syringe and injected into the indented areas of the hips, where more volume is needed.

The newly injected fat connects to a new blood supply from your body, allowing this new tissue to receive the nourishment required to survive. Some of these cells will remain in the area permanently.

Take The Dips From The Hips

Trochanteric depressions, also known as hip dips are normal anatomical features in both men and women. They are the slightly hollow areas that curve inward along the sides of the body just below your hip bones. The location of the hip dips slightly differs between individuals based on their bone and muscular structure. Some hip dips are more noticeable than others. In addition to that, many people have unwanted, stubborn fat in the love handles, lower back, and outer thighs which can make the hip dips look more concave and cause ones body to look disproportionate.

What Is Fat Grafting For Hip Dip Treatment

Fat grafting, also called liposculpting, is a surgical hip dip treatment in which fat is suctioned from one part of your body and injected into the hip dip area, filling it up to make them look round and voluminous. Alternatively, silicone implants or artificial fillers may also be used to fill up the hip dip instead of fat grafts.

Some people are scared of surgical procedures. However, fat grafting is a low-risk and simple surgical procedure with a negligible risk of side effects or complications. Some of the potential side effects of fat grafting are bruising and pain at the site of incisions, swelling, and scarring. However, in most cases, the side-effects dissipate gradually.

What Exactly Are Hip Dips

Total Hip Replacement – Exercises 9-12 Weeks After Surgery

Were accustomed to seeing a streamlined, half-circle profile that bends out at the hip and curves back at the thigh in popular portrayals of bodies, particularly feminine ones.

While this may be an image that we take for granted as a normal or desired way to seem, the reality is that many peoples bodies simply do not look like this.

Hip dips, often known as violin hips, are indentations that form around the curvature of your hips and thighs when you walk. Indentations on the sides of your hips can occur when the skin on your hips is more closely bonded to the trochanter, which is a deeper section of your thigh bone.

These indentations can be made more obvious by the way your fat is distributed and the amount of fat you have on your body. When it comes to hip dips, there is nothing wrong with them anatomically. They do not pose any kind of medical risk. Some people, however, are self-conscious about their hip dips since they are so prominent.

    How Many Vials Of Sculptra For Hip Dips

    Typically a total of 20 to 30 vials of Sculptra are needed to achieve full correction of hip dips, and achieve the desired hourglass figure. If a full Sculptra BBL is desired, with a booty lift, then a larger number of vials of Sculptra will be necessary. The exact number of vials depends on the architecture and anatomy of each individual patient and how large a correction is needed and the exact size of buttock augmentation which is desired.

    What You Need To Know Before You Go For Butt Injections

    Butt injections are not permanent. Hip fillers that are used for it eventually get absorbed by the body. If you lead an active lifestyle with plenty of exercises, then the injected product can get absorbed too quickly. This means that after a certain time you will have to repeat the procedure So, budget for it prior to going ahead with it initially.

    To prolong the result of hip fillers, do not go for a massage during the time the product is settling down. Because it will increase the speed of biodegradation and you will need touch ups much faster. Give it at least a month.

    Also, during the first day after the procedure try to keep water and especially your hands off the injection sites.

    Do not sunbathe for two weeks.

    Stay away from swimming pools and sauna for one week.

    Do not use laser over the injection site.
